A1 Systems has enabled the subscribers of Tele2 to change the network’s name

Tele2 subscribers in Russia will now be able to change the network’s name on the screens of their smartphones. The service allows its users to make up their own name for the network.

One of A1 System’s solutions was used for the launch — A1S OTA that allows to remotely control the settings of SIMs and eSIM profiles as well as to change SPN (service provider name).

The service is available for any data plan, both private and business customers of Tele2. The network’s name should have 15 signs or less and can contain Latin letters, numbers, and/or special symbols (!@#.,&?/).

The connection to the service is available through interactive communication or via sending the USSD-command. The service is possible to manage through USSD or a personal account.

A1 Systems company held the whole range of work to make the solution come to life: worked through the business logic, performed the integration with the operator’s billing, offered and regulated its own OTA platform.

Before integration, the solution went through a thorough R&D process. The integration was special because various phones work differently with SPN on SIMs. Similarly, the SIMs used by subscribers are different too — they can be produced by different manufacturers and can differ from version to version. This information has been meticulously studied and analyzed by the A1 Systems engineers. As a result, the control signals for SIM and eSIM have been selected in a way that enables 95% of Tele2 subscribers to use the service.
